I raise hundreds of Bobwhite's every year and currently looking for a good quality shipping box, so I can ship up to 25-50 at a time. Any ideas? I don't want to spend retail, would rather purchase large quantities at a discount. What are you guys using? Thanks!
 
I don't know if you are even allowed to ship that many....

I use boxesforbirds.com or something like that, they are sized for pigeons, so they work well for quail. The 8 bird box is a double decker with dividers for each quail, and I really liked it.

Hope this helps!
 
For Day Old Babies You Can Ship In Chick Flats, All Other Must Go In Horizon Type Boxes Which Are Made In Single Stall And Multiple Nest Boxes

MUCH LIKE EVERY WHITE COTURNIX IS AUTOMATICALLY CALLED AN A&m, ALL SHIPPING BOXES HAVE THE ACQUIRED NAME OF HORIZON BOXES.... THERE ARE A FEW OTHER BRANDS OUT THERE, DONT KNOW IF THEY ARE ANY CHEAPER OR NOT THO. YOU CAN ALWAYS LOOK AT THE AUCTION SITES AND FIND THEM IN QUANTITY EBAY, OVABID, THE NEW EGG-BID.COM, EGGBID.NET

IF SHIPPING 25 LG JUVIES OR ADULTS THEY MAKE A PIGEON NEST THAT IS A DECENT SIZE, PROBABLY 24-32 INCHES SQUARE. FOLKS USE THEM TO SHIP RACING PIGEONS AROUND HERE ALL THE TIME.
 
Horizon does have a 'new' quail shipper, it's basically a modified chick shipping box. I don't know how many they hold, or if they are even available for purchase. The last time I checked their site it just said 'coming fall of 2010' for the quail shippers.
